Solar energy can be harnessed two primary ways: photovoltaics (PVs) are semiconductors that generate electricity directly from sunlight, while solar thermal technologies use sunlight to heat water for domestic uses, to warm buildings, or heat fluids to drive electricity-generating turbines. What is a solar-powered greenhouse? A solar-powered greenhouse combines traditional greenhouse technology with solar panels, allowing it to generate its own energy.
